This is a low severity * problem that results from using RESTART * OBJECTS (specified in CONFIG.SYS). Customers * will notice that, upon rebooting their system, * they will have a duplicate desktop folder. * This folder can be easily, manually closed * with no further customer impact. * * "Closing applications results in cross-hatched PJ11814 * icons." After an application terminates, the PJ12544 * cross-hatching (which indicates the application * is executing) should disappear. Intermittently, * this is not happening. Despite the cross- * hatching problem, the applications close * successfully and the customer's work is not * interrupted. The cross-hatching disappears * upon re-boot. * * "System hangs upon exiting Forbrowse." PJ13370 * This problem results in a Trap D and is a * high-severity problem. However, it only * affects customers running Forbrowse. * Customers who are not running Forbrowse have * not reported this problem. * * "Workplace logon shows on first boot on remote PJ13647 * IPL client." This very low severity problem * only affects client workstations that are * being remotely IPL'ed from a server. If a user * clicks on an object, the logon disappears. * There is no further customer impact from this * problem. ************************************************************************ * * Special Instructions for Marketing Reps, SEs and Field Support: * * The files contained in this package may be distributed to * IBM customers who are already licensed owners of OS/2 Version * 2.x, or by IBM marketing/service personnel authorized to service that * customer. * ************************************************************************ BRWPPK ZIPBIN *
